HP PhotoSmart 850

HP PhotoSmart 850
Sunday June 01, 2003
Written by Darren Ellis
Tags: HP | PhotoSmart | 850
AUD
$1399
Price at time of review.
The HP PhotoSmart 850 has a huge protruding lens, and a fairly fast-responding display and a clever feature that turns off either the viewfinder or the LCD if not required (depending on which one you're using at the time).
